How is the short thermal treatment for the mouth and gums carried out?

Duration & Schedule

5 or 10 days of morning treatments.

Optional medical supervision available when booking.

Daily Treatments of the Short Thermal Treatment

Each day, the short thermal treatment for the mouth and gums includes 3 targeted treatments using natural thermal water:

  • 1 Gargle: gentle rinsing to prepare the oral cavity for the other treatments.
  • 1 Oral Cavity Spray: a fine jet of thermal water dispersed through a screen to bathe the entire oral cavity.
  • 1 Gum Shower: using a fork with multiple small holes to massage the oral cavity (gums, palate, tongue, etc.); soothing and decongesting effects.

Frequently Asked Questions about the Oral Health Thermal Treatment

How long does each session last?

Each session lasts approximately 1 hour, over a half-day adapted to your needs.

Is a medical certificate required?

A certificate of non-contraindication is sufficient.

Is the short thermal treatment reimbursed?

It is not reimbursed by social security, but some health insurance providers may offer partial coverage.

Is it suitable for adolescents or children?

Yes, the treatment can be followed by children and adolescents from 3 years old, accompanied by a parent if necessary.
